What is Empathy?

Empathy is more than just a buzzword; it’s a vital component of human interaction. It’s what makes us pause to listen to a friend’s troubles or offer a helping hand to a stranger. Empathy is often categorized into three types:

Blog post illustration

– Cognitive Empathy: Understanding another’s perspective.
– Emotional Empathy: Feeling what another person feels.
– Compassionate Empathy: Taking action to help someone in distress.

Developing empathy can lead to improved relationships and a greater sense of community. But how do we cultivate this crucial skill? That’s where meditation comes in.

Understanding Meditation

Meditation is a practice that involves focusing the mind to achieve a state of calm and clarity. While there are numerous forms of meditation, many share common goals: reducing stress, enhancing concentration, and promoting emotional well-being. Mindfulness meditation, for instance, encourages individuals to be present in the moment, acknowledging their thoughts and feelings without judgment.

By regularly practicing meditation, individuals can become more attuned to their inner worlds, which in turn, enhances their ability to connect with the external world, including the people around them.

How Meditation Enhances Empathy

So, how exactly does meditation enhance empathy? Here are a few key ways:

1. Increased Self-Awareness

Meditation fosters self-awareness by encouraging individuals to observe their thoughts and emotions. This heightened awareness allows individuals to better understand their own feelings, which is a crucial step in recognizing and empathizing with others’ emotions.

2. Emotional Regulation

Through meditation, individuals learn to manage their emotions more effectively. This control can prevent overwhelming emotions from clouding judgment, allowing for a more empathetic response to others.

3. Improved Focus

Meditation enhances concentration, making it easier for individuals to fully engage in conversations and be present with others. This presence is essential for truly understanding and empathizing with another’s experience.

4. Compassion Cultivation

Meditation practices like loving-kindness meditation are specifically designed to cultivate compassion. By focusing on generating feelings of love and kindness towards oneself and others, individuals can deepen their empathetic connections.

Scientific Evidence Supporting Meditation and Empathy

Numerous studies highlight the connection between meditation and increased empathy. Research published in the journal “Social Cognitive and Affective Neuroscience” found that participants who engaged in meditation showed increased activation in brain areas associated with empathy and emotional regulation.

Furthermore, a study in “Psychological Science” demonstrated that individuals who practiced loving-kindness meditation exhibited greater empathy and altruistic behavior. These findings underscore the potential of meditation to foster a more empathetic and compassionate society.

Incorporating Meditation into Your Daily Routine

Ready to enhance your empathy through meditation? Here are some tips to get started:

1. Start Small

Begin with just a few minutes of meditation each day, gradually increasing the duration as you become more comfortable with the practice.

2. Choose a Technique

Experiment with different forms of meditation, such as mindfulness or loving-kindness meditation, to find what resonates with you.

3. Be Consistent

Establish a regular meditation routine to experience the full benefits. Consistency is key to developing a deeper empathetic connection.

4. Use Guided Meditations

If you’re new to meditation, consider using guided meditation apps or videos to help you get started.
